Transaction 051287ca81a2b32bf598ac0f84cd66fd2128214c117968537101025fd89ec0ad

1 Input
2 Outputs
  • 051287ca81a2b32bf598ac0f84cd66fd2128214c117968537101025fd89ec0ad:0
  • value  240000
    address  1GHDMgfU7whvFWZmrH244xSPEDM9Kp9q6S
  • 051287ca81a2b32bf598ac0f84cd66fd2128214c117968537101025fd89ec0ad:1
  • value  25175145
    address  37EWKQRx4AnzdA7Yf6fMaEeQMnFkJBZdfp